How they compare

Oman currently reports 4,384 against 3,960 in Kuwait, a difference of 424.

That makes Oman's figure about 1.1 times Kuwait's.

The two have swapped places 1 time across 12 shared years of data; in 2006 it was Oman ahead.

Kuwait ranks 63rd and Oman ranks 61st of 166 countries.

Across the 3 decades both report, Kuwait averaged higher in 1 and Oman in 2.
